•John has two ATM transactions but only one of them has a fee (Interac). Why?
Interac is an out-of-network ATM and First Bank charges customers if they use out of network atms

What is the impact of the Online Funds Transfer - From Savings that appears on John's statement?
John's Savings account balance declined by $50 and his Checking account balance increased by $50

What was the result of John overdrawing his checking account?
John's payment was greater than the balance he had available in his account so he was charged a $35 fee.
Which fees was John charged on his checking account during this statement period?
ATM Fee, Overdraft Fee, Maintenance Fee
What is the mathematical formula that you would use to describe the finarcial activity on a bank. statement?
Ending Balance = Previous Balance + Deposits - Withdrawals
